Cloud Service >> Knowledgebase >> How To >> How to Diagnose and Fix Common Networking Issues in Cloud Environments
submit query

Cut Hosting Costs! Submit Query Today!

How to Diagnose and Fix Common Networking Issues in Cloud Environments

As businesses increasingly rely on cloud environments for hosting and services, network reliability becomes crucial. Cloud networking issues can lead to service disruptions, slow performance, and decreased productivity. Diagnosing and fixing these common problems is essential for maintaining a seamless user experience. In this guide, we will explore effective strategies for identifying and resolving networking issues in cloud environments, particularly when leveraging services like those offered by Cyfuture Cloud.

Understanding Common Networking Issues

Before diving into solutions, it’s important to understand the common networking issues that can arise in cloud environments:

Latency Issues: High latency can significantly affect application performance, leading to delays in data transfer and user interactions.

Packet Loss: When data packets fail to reach their destination, applications may suffer from interruptions or degraded performance.

Connectivity Problems: These can occur due to misconfigurations, hardware failures, or issues with your Internet Service Provider (ISP), resulting in users being unable to access hosted services.

Firewall Misconfigurations: Improper firewall settings can block legitimate traffic, making it impossible for users to connect to services or applications hosted in the cloud.

DNS Issues: Domain Name System (DNS) problems can lead to users being unable to reach your applications, causing frustrating delays.

Step-by-Step Diagnosis and Fixing Process

1. Identify the Symptoms

The first step in troubleshooting networking issues is to identify the symptoms. Are users experiencing slow load times, or are they completely unable to access certain services? Gathering information from users can help pinpoint the issue more effectively.

2. Check Network Performance Metrics

Using performance monitoring tools can provide valuable insights into network health. Look for metrics such as:

Latency: Measure round-trip times to identify any delays in data transmission.

Packet Loss: Monitor the percentage of lost packets to assess connection stability.

Bandwidth Usage: Ensure you are not exceeding your bandwidth limits, which can lead to slowdowns.

Cyfuture Cloud’s hosting services include comprehensive monitoring solutions to track these metrics effectively.

3. Review Network Configuration

Misconfigurations are a common source of networking issues. Review the following:

Firewall Rules: Ensure that firewall rules are properly set to allow necessary traffic. Review both inbound and outbound rules to prevent blocking legitimate connections.

Routing Tables: Check routing configurations to ensure that data packets are being directed to the correct paths.

Network Interfaces: Ensure all network interfaces are correctly configured and operational.

Cyfuture Cloud’s colocation services can help by offering dedicated support and expertise in network configuration management.

4. Test Connectivity

Conduct connectivity tests to determine where the failure occurs. Use tools such as:

Ping: This command checks if a specific IP address or domain is reachable, providing insight into latency and packet loss.

Traceroute: This tool helps visualize the path packets take to reach their destination, highlighting where delays or issues occur.

DNS Lookup: Verify that domain names resolve correctly to their respective IP addresses, ensuring users can access the intended services.

5. Investigate DNS Issues

DNS problems can often masquerade as other connectivity issues. To troubleshoot:

Flush DNS Cache: Sometimes outdated or corrupted DNS entries can cause connectivity issues. Flushing the DNS cache can resolve this.

Check DNS Configuration: Ensure DNS records are accurate and up to date, reflecting any recent changes to IP addresses or services.

6. Analyze Logs

Review server and application logs for any error messages that could indicate networking issues. Look for:

Connection timeout errors.

Authentication failures.

Firewall blocks or dropped packets.

Cyfuture Cloud’s managed services provide log analysis tools that help detect and troubleshoot these issues quickly.

7. Collaborate with Your ISP

If the problem persists after checking your configuration and performance metrics, it may be time to contact your ISP. They can assist in identifying any broader network issues that could be affecting your cloud environment.

8. Implement Solutions and Monitor Results

Once you have diagnosed the issue and implemented solutions, continuously monitor the network to ensure the changes have resolved the problem. Keeping an eye on performance metrics can help identify potential issues before they escalate into significant problems.

Conclusion

Diagnosing and fixing common networking issues in cloud environments requires a systematic approach. By understanding the symptoms, checking performance metrics, reviewing configurations, and utilizing diagnostic tools, you can effectively identify and resolve network problems. Cyfuture Cloud’s hosting, services, and colocation solutions provide the resources and expertise necessary to maintain optimal network performance, ensuring that your cloud environment operates smoothly.

By following these steps, businesses can enhance their network reliability, minimize downtime, and provide users with a seamless experience in their cloud-hosted applications. Keeping networking issues at bay allows companies to focus on growth and innovation, which is essential in today’s fast-paced digital landscape.

Cut Hosting Costs! Submit Query Today!

Grow With Us

Let’s talk about the future, and make it happen!